
It turned out,
When Atlas Shrugged,
His overcoat tumbled.
As it hit the ground,
It was clear
That he was not,
As had been presupposed,
The single Titan
Ruggedly
Propping the sky
No, he was, actually,
A vast collective
Of those folk
The people who
Saw in themselves an echo
Of the false Atlas
Had sneered at
And mocked for their
“Disposability”.
Now, as clouds tumbled,
And dreams died,
There was no one
To flip those comforting
Burgers for pennies
